Features
The GAMEON Emperor Arctic I Series boasts an array of features that contribute to its overall appeal and functionality:
- 7x 120mm Pre-Installed aRGB Fans: The case comes equipped with 7x 120mm aRGB fans, offering excellent airflow and customizable lighting effects. This is a significant advantage for gamers who want their systems to look and run their best.
- Up to 360mm Radiator Support: The case supports up to a 360mm radiator, allowing for powerful liquid cooling solutions. This feature is particularly beneficial for overclocking enthusiasts or those who want to push their components to their limits.
- 0.8mm Tempered Glass: The case features a large tempered glass side panel that offers an unobstructed view of the components and lighting. This is a key feature for those who want to showcase their custom builds.
- Spacious Interior: The case offers ample space for high-end components, including long graphics cards and tall CPU coolers. This makes it compatible with a wide range of builds.
- Dust Filters: The case includes dust filters on the upper cover and bottom plate, keeping your components clean and protected from dust accumulation.
- I/O Ports: The front panel features HD Audio, USB 3.0 x 1, and USB 2.0 x 2 ports for easy access to peripherals.

Specifications
Feature | Specification |
---|---|
Motherboard Compatibility | E-ATX/ATX/M-ATX |
Power (Watt) | No |
Lighting Type | ARGB+PWM |
PSU | Power Supply Length Limit: 200mm |
Materials | SPCC |
Fan Support | Front: 3x 120/140mm, 2x 180/200mm |
GPU Length | 410mm |
CPU Clearance | 185mm |
Drive | HDD: 2, SSD: 2 |
I/O Ports | HD Audio, USB 3.0 x 1, USB 2.0 x 2 |
Extension Slots | 7 |
Dust Filters | Upper cover and bottom plate dust filters |
Tempered Glass | 0.8mm |
Packaging Size (W x H x D) | 550mm x 300mm x 543mm |
Accessories Included | Parts package |
NW Weight | 6.36 KG |
GW Weight | 7.68 KG |
Product Size | 465mm x 230mm x 495mm |
Other Spec | 7 x 120mm ARGB+PWM fans pre-installed |
